Official: Total area of designed territory of Garakhanbayli village is 316 hectares

The total area of the planned territory for Karakhanbayli village in Fuzuli district is 316 hectares, Leyla Sarabi, spokesperson for the Restoration, Construction, and Management Service in Aghdam, Fuzuli, and Khojavand districts of Azerbaijan, told Report.
According to her, the initial phase of the project includes the construction of 1,479 individual houses.
"In the first stage, 87 hectares will be developed. A total of 404 private houses will be built, including 2-, 3-, and 5-room homes. The plan also includes a school for 528 students, a kindergarten for 120 children, and a medical center," she added.
